Cheran, Zoning Administrator`' -------- RE: Revocation of Conditional Use Permit 409-04 for a Cottage Occupation for a Real Estate Brokerage Office DATE: April 2, 2008 The Frederick County Board of Supervisors approved Conditional Use Permit (CUP) #09-04 (applicable to Property Identification Numbers 52-A-56 and 52-A-55) for a cottage occupation as a real estate brokerage office on July 14, 2004, with the following conditions: 1. All review agency comments and requirements shall be complied with at all times. 2. No more than five customers at any one time. 3. Any proposed business sign shall conform to cottage occupation sign requirements, and shall not exceed four square -feet in size. 4. Any expansion or modification of facilities will require a new Conditional Use Permit. 5. Up to two temporary employees allowed. Since the approval of this CUP, staff has notified the applicant on numerous occasions of a violation of condition #3 regarding signs on the property. More specifically, the business sign posted on the property exceeds the allowable four square feet size requirement, resulting in a violation of their CUP. Staff also advised of concern with a second sign on the property which appeared to advertise a real estate office. On February 20, 2008, the Planning Commission recommended that the CUP be revoked because of the continuing violations. On March 12, 2008, the Board of Supervisors tabled action on the revocation for 30 days to enable the applicant to resolve the illegal sign concerns. Since the March 12, 2008, Board meeting, the applicant has removed the signs from the property, and has submitted a sketch of a proposed business sign that dimensionally complies with the CUP's cottage occupation sign requirement. Application for a sign permit has not been made at this time. In an effort to more affectively manage the signage permitted on this CUP site, staff would suggest that if the Board is inclined to allow the CUP to continue, that the Board revise CUP condition #3 to read: 3. Any proposed business sign shall conform to cottage occupation sign requirements, and shall not exceed four square -feet in size. Any other sign will not be allowed unless the cottage occupation sign is removed. (Sign to include real estate sign for applicant's property not to advertise Bayliss Realty Office.) Staff is available should you have questions. Thank you. 107 North rent Street, Suite 202 a Winchester, Virginia 22601-5000 Page 2 Frederick County Board of Supervisors Re: Revocation of CUP #09-04 for Real Estate Brokerage Office April 2, 2008 Supplemental Information on Case History Violation of Conditions: Staff received a complaint regarding violations of the CUP #09-04 with regards to size and number of signs located on the property. The property has two signs located on the property, which do not meet the requirements of Condition 3 of Conditional Use Permit #09-04. Staff has met with the property owner and discussed the sign issue in order to bring the property into compliance with the conditions of the Conditional Use Permit. A third letter of revocation was sent to the property owner most recently on December 12, 2007. Staff conclusions for the 02/20/08 Planning Commission Meeting: The holder of Conditional Use Permit #09-04 is in violation of the above -referenced conditions with regards to the size and number of signs on the property. Summary and Action of the Planning Commission meeting on 02/20/08: The applicant and his legal counsel stated that the property on which the CUP was granted (PIN 52-A-56) does not have a sign at this time; however, his adjoining property (PIN 52-A-55) contains a realty sign advertising the sale of his residence. The Planning Commission noted that the applicant applied for both properties under his CUP application. Commission members believed the existing sign had the appearance of a sign advertising Mr. Bayliss' business, rather than a "For Sale" sign because it contained a directional arrow with the word, "office." In addition, the sign exceeded the size limitation of four square -feet. They questioned whether it was an off -premises business sign, which would require a CUP. Commissioners suggested the applicant place an appropriately -sized business sign onto the property for which the original CUP was granted (PIN 52-A- 56) and place a typical For -Sale sign on the adjacent property (PIN 52-A-55) advertising the sale of his residence. The applicant contended that the existing sign was no different than any realty sign posted in Frederick County. There were no public comments. The Planning Commission unanimously recommended that CUP #09- 04 of James and Barbara Bayliss be revoked due to a violation of the conditions of the permit, specifically regarding the size of the sign and the appearance of an off -premise business sign. (Note: Commissioner Manuel abstained; Commissioners Ambrogi, Triplett, and Mohn were absent from the meeting.) Staff Comments for Board of Supervisors Meeting March 12, 2008: The applicant was cited for an illegal business and sign (s) on April 5, 2004. The applicant applied for a Conditional Use Permit (CUP #09-04) for a cottage occupation on the property, to bring the property into compliance with the Frederick County Zoning Ordinance. At the June 2, 2004 Planning Commission meeting, members explained to the applicant about the size requirements for a cottage occupation sign, which is two feet -by -two feet, not four feet -by -four feet. The applicant acknowledged that the current sign was too large and would modify any sign to meet the Page 3 Frederick County Board of Supervisors Re: Revocation of CUP #09-04 for Real Estate Brokerage Office April 2, 2008 requirements of a cottage occupation sign. This CUP was approved by the Board of Supervisors on July 14, 2004. Staff received complaints with regards to the size and the number of signs located on the property. Staff met with and notified the applicant via certified mail that the applicant was in violation of the conditions placed on CUP # 09-04. The applicant has not removed the sign (s) and was scheduled for revocation of CUP #09-04. As noted above, the Planning Commission at their February 20, 2008 meeting voted for revocation of CUP #09-04. Staff has included attachments associated with CUP #09-04 for your review. Summary and Action of the Board of Supervisors meeting on 03/12/08: Mr. Cheran presented the staff report stating that Mr. Bayliss is not in compliance with requirement #3 of his CUP regarding size and number of signs located on the property. Mr. Bayliss acknowledged that the sign in question did exceed four square feet and he asked the Board for a 30 day extension so he could work with Mr. Cheran because he wanted to have a real estate sign in addition to the sign allowed by the CUP. Some of the Supervisors had concerns because this issue has been going on for three and a half years and it is obvious what needs to be done to bring the sign issue into compliance. The Board determined that no signs are to be placed on the property until approved by the Zoning Administrator and Mr. Bayliss is in compliance with CUP #09-04. The Board tabled action of the revocation for 30 days. Update since 3/12/08 Board meeting: The applicant has since submitted to staff a sign plan that meets the cottage occupation sign requirements. Staff suggests a revision to Condition #3 to enable the continued use of the CUP with the stipulations that only one sign shall be on the CUP property (identified by PIN 52-A-56 and 52-A-55) at any given time.
